codebuttonmod2 Plugin

Compatible with DokuWiki

No compatibility info given!

plugin Inserts two code buttons into the toolbar. Include code copy-to-clipboard feature.

Usage

Markup

Three new buttons are included in the toolbar.

  • The first button include the functionalities of codebuttonmod1 (download link by default): “<code | download>Insert_Code</code>
  • The second button adds a simple “<code>Insert_Code</code>” markup.
  • The third button adds “Insert_Code” for inline code.
Published pages

With a left click on the code blocks the code is copied to the clipboard.
